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(7 edits)

1.   0.5.5d

2.   Win7 64bit

3.    "The "end of day" button fails to work properly specifically, when I click the button food is consumed or added, gold from professions is added, health is regenerated, and all of the other things that change because of the end of a day change.   EXCEPT that no end of day  report is generated,  the masters energy is not regenerated. and the game doesn't save".

 I can access the job report by clicking on the button near the finish day but the global report remains empty.

4.  I think I found the problem in my case and how to replicate

At first i thought it depends on some "phantom" equip of captured slaves.  Some Gear Slot pictures dont show up under equip (I mean the grey char picture with the equip slots). This happens to all races, some work and others dont, even if there are same race (example Human).  But furter testing shows that´s not the problem which leads to the broken daily report. In my case it´s related to two specific race typs: Demons & Slimes.   As soon as I get a demon or slime slave inside the Mansion (except Jail), I get this broken daily report.  All other races seems to working fine, even if there is a missing equip slot picture.

edit: the error show´s "Invalid get Index ´luxury´(on base: ´Nil´).  At: res://files/scripts/Mansion.gdc:791"

edit 2: I´ve also  registered something strange in Mansion Upgrade Screen:    "Free Upgrade Points: 19.65601"  ??  .65601 ??

I hope I could help - excuse the poor english, I´m not a native english speaker

Have you tried updating to 0.5.5e?

(1 edit)

strange thing. Itch.io show´s still 0.5.5d on the site, but the downloaded S4P is 0.5.5e

But unfortunately the daily report is still broken in my save as soon as a demon or slime joins from jail into the mansions other rooms.

I try now to start a new game... hopefully this problem is only in my save (from 0.5.5c)

btw. thanks, you made really a great game, I enjoy playing it

(5 edits)

1.  0.5.5e

2.  Win7 64bit

3. broken Daily Report

4.  startet new game but unfortunately the report is still broken if I put a demon or slime somewhere else in the mansion than the jail.

the error show´s:


SCRIPT ERROR: person.count luxury: Invalid get index 'I41' (on base: 'Dictionary').

At: res://globals.gdc:1180

SCRIPT ERROR: _on_end_pressed: Invalid get index 'luxury' (on base: 'Nil'').

At: res://files/scripts/Mansion.gdc:791


Edit:  I tested some more. Maybe my first thought was correct, it seems that "phantom" gear is responsible for the the broken daily report. example: a nereid with missing gear screen (this one with the grey char pic and equip slots) leads to a broken daily report if the slave isnt inside the jail. A other nereid with functional gear screen dosnt lead to this bug. Unfortunately I got not a single demon or slime with working gear screen to test furter (only offspring). In my game (fresh startet with 0.5.5e) all arachna, demon, slime, lamia, harpy and partially some other races (goblin) wich I captured in the lands have a missing or broken gear screen and placed inside a mansion room (not Jail) gives the broken daily report. But in total -> missing gear screen -> broken daily report if inside a mansion room. I also found out that I can place or replace some gear on them (even if I´m not seeing it), EXEPT weapons. No matter if they are in jail or a mansion room. On the other hand, offspring of those "broken" slaves (tested with demons) works fine, functional gear screen and no broken daily report. 

I hope this helps.